Islamabad: The government has announced a reduction in the price of petrol.
A notification has been issued by the Ministry of Finance regarding changes in the prices of petroleum products.
According to the notification, the price of petrol per liter has been reduced by Rs8.

After a reduction of Rs 8, the new price of petrol has been fixed at Rs 259.34 per liter.
The price of diesel remains unchanged at Rs 276.21 per liter.
The price of kerosene has been reduced by Rs 1.97 per liter after which the new price of kerosene oil has been fixed at Rs 186.86.
The price of light diesel oil has also been reduced by Rs0.92, the new price has been fixed at Rs 164.83 per liter.
According to the notification, the new price of petrol was applicable from 12:00 am today (Tuesday).
